1.0.17 • Published 3 years ago
nexti-bff-types v1.0.17
💻 Sobre o projeto
O módulo BFF types tem como responsabilidade exportar toda a tipagem do bff da Nexti.
⚙️ Arquitetura de módulos
- Types: os arquivos dentro da pasta types, correspondem a tipagem de todos os parâmetros de requisição e retorno das APIs do BFF.
🚀 Como executar o projeto
Pré-requisitos
Antes de começar, você vai precisar ter instalado em sua máquina as seguintes ferramentas: Git, Node.js, Yarn. Além disto é bom ter um editor para trabalhar com o código como VSCode
🎲 Realizando o build da aplicação
# Clone este repositório
$ git clone git@github.com:nexti-frontend/bff.git
# Vá para a pasta @npm-driver-service-dashboard no terminal/cmd
$ cd services/dashboard/@bff-types
# Instale as dependências
$ yarn
# Realize o build do pacote
$ yarn build
# Publique o pacote na npm store
$ yarn publish
# O pacote ficará disponível na npm store com o alias @nexti/bff-types
💡Para realizar a publicação, utilizamos a ferramenta codeartifact da AWS, que tem a responsabilidade de publicar o pacote. Sendo um pacote privado, é necessário registrar o .nmprc no projeto que estiver consumindo a biblioteca. Para tal, é necessário apenas copiar o arquivo .npmrc do presente projeto, para o projeto que consumirá o pacote.
📝 Licença
Este projeto esta sobe a licença MIT.